Technip Energies Secures Engineering Contract for BP's H2Teesside Hydrogen Plant with Carbon Capture
Contract Overview
* Technip Energies has secured a significant engineering contract from BP for the H2Teesside hydrogen production facility. * The facility aims to produce 500 million cubic feet of hydrogen per day and capture 98% of the associated carbon dioxide emissions.
Project Significance
* The H2Teesside plant is part of BP's ambitious plans to become a net-zero emissions company by 2050. * The project is expected to play a crucial role in the UK's transition to a low-carbon economy by providing clean hydrogen for power generation, transportation, and industrial processes. * The integration of carbon capture and storage (CCS) technology will minimize the environmental impact of hydrogen production.
Technip Energies' Role
* Technip Energies will provide engineering services for the plant's hydrogen production, carbon capture, and utilities systems. * The company's expertise in CCS and hydrogen infrastructure will support BP's vision for a sustainable hydrogen economy. * This contract strengthens Technip Energies' position as a leading provider of clean energy solutions.
Environmental Impact
* The H2Teesside plant is expected to create 2,000 jobs during construction and operation. * The plant's carbon capture capabilities will prevent millions of tons of CO2 from being released into the atmosphere annually. * The project contributes to the UK's goal of achieving net-zero emissions by 2050.
